body, a, p, h1, h2, h3, td, option, .text-a, .donation-caption, .donate, .donate1 { color: #000000; font-size: 12px; font-family: Verdana; margin: 0; padding: 0; }
.donation-caption{padding: 0px; margin: 0px; }
.main-border {	border-left: 1px solid #003366;border-right: 1px solid #003366;}
p {
 padding-top: 5px;
 padding-bottom: 5px;
	
 line-height: 18px;
}

input, select {background-color: #FFFFFF !important;}

.top-menu, .top-menu a {color: #3a6189; background-color: #cfd8e2; font-family: Verdana; font-size: 11px; text-decoration: none; font-weight: bold; cursor: pointer;} 
.top-menu-hover, .top-menu-hover a {color: #3a6189; background-color: #FFFFFF; font-family: Verdana; font-size: 11px; text-decoration: none; font-weight: bold; cursor: pointer;} 

a {color: #0000ff; font-size: 12px; font-family: Georgia;}
h1 {
 color: #003366;
 font-size: 16px;
 font-family: Georgia;
 margin: 0;
 font-weight: bold;
 padding-top: 8px;
}
h2 {
 color: #003366;
 font-size: 14px;
 font-weight: bold;
 padding-top: 5px;
}
h3 {
 font-size: 12px;
 font-weight: bold;
 padding-top: 8px;
}
li {padding-bottom: 10px; }

ul {padding-bottom: 3px;
margin-bottom: 3px;}

input.donate, select.donate { width: 250px; height: 20px; border: solid 1px #87acc0;padding: 0px; margin: 0px;}
textarea.donate { width: 250px; height: 80px; border: solid 1px #87acc0;padding: 0px; margin: 0px;}
.donate1 { height: 20px; border: solid 1px #87acc0;}

.top-input { color: #1d658b; font-size: 9px; font-family: arial; width: 119px; height: 15px; border: solid 1px #87acc0; padding-top:-5px;}
.essentials-table { background-color: #8099b2; margin: 0; padding: 10px 10px 10px 15px; border: solid 1px #c0d2e1; }
.essentials-table-text { color: #FFFFFF; font-family: Arial; font-size: 16px; font-weight: bold; padding-bottom: 5px;}
.essentials-link:hover { color: #fff; font-size: 12px; font-family: Georgia; text-decoration: underline; padding-top: 2px; padding-bottom: 2px; }
.essentials-link { color: #fff; font-size: 12px;  font-weight: normal; font-family: Georgia; text-decoration: none; padding-top: 0px; padding-bottom: 0px; }
.essential-item {  margin: 0; padding: 10px 0 0 15px; color: #fff; font-weight: normal; font-size: 13px; font-family: "times new roman";}
.essential-li { padding-top: 2px; padding-bottom: 2px; font-weight: normal; }
.body-block { padding: 10px 15px 0px 0px; color: #000000; font-size: 12px; font-weight: normal;}
.body-block-title {padding-top: 15px; color: #0e5881; }
.heading {font-family: Arial;}
.bottom-text { color: #548aae; font-size: 10px; font-family: Georgia; font-weight: bold; text-decoration: none; }
.bottom-text a { color: #548aae; font-size: 10px; font-family: Georgia; font-weight: bold; text-decoration: none; }
.bottom-text a:hover { color: #548aae; font-size: 10px; font-family: Georgia; font-weight: bold; text-decoration: underline; }

.digest-title {color: #0e5881; font-size: 14px; font-family: Georgia; margin: 0; font-weight: bold;}


/*<agl.folder "Articles">*/
.articles-nav-panel, .articles-list-cat {font-size: 12px; font-family: Georgia; color: #0d4173;}
.articles-nav-panel a, .articles-list-cat-link {font-size: 12px; font-family: Georgia; color: #0d4173;}
.article-title {color: #0e5881; font-size: 14px; font-family: Georgia; margin: 0; padding: 10px 0 5px;}
.article-author {font-family: Verdana; font-size: 11px;color: #0e5881; margin:0;}
.article-date {font-family: Verdana; font-size: 11px;color: #0e5881; margin:0;}
.article-body p {padding-top: 15px;}
.article-body ul {padding-bottom: 0px; margin-bottom: 0px;}
.article-button {padding-top: 5px; padding-bottom: 5px; font-family: Georgia; font-size: 10px; color: #8AB21C;}
.article-button:hover {color: #556E11;}

.article-cat-title {padding-top: 5px; padding-bottom: 5px; font-family: Georgia; font-size: 18px;color: #363737; font-weight: bold; margin: 0;}
.articles-list-article-title {padding-top: 5px; padding-bottom: 5px; font-family: Georgia; font-size: 14px; color: #000000; font-weight: bold; margin: 0;}
.search-result-article-title {padding-top: 5px; padding-bottom: 5px; font-family: Georgia; font-size: 13px; color: #000000; font-weight: bold; margin: 0;}
.search-result-title {color: #0e5881; font-size: 13px; font-family: Georgia; margin: 0; padding: 10px 0 5px;}
.article-description {font-family: Verdana; font-size: 12px;color: #000000; margin:0;}
.articles-list-cat-title {padding-top: 5px; padding-bottom: 5px; }
.articles-list-cat-title a {padding-top: 5px; padding-bottom: 5px; font-family: Georgia; font-size: 14px; color: #0e5881; font-weight: bold; margin: 0;}

/*</agl.folder>*/

.ngo-letter { color: #184970; font-size: 13px; font-family: Georgia; font-weight: bold; text-decoration: none; margin: 0; padding: 5px; }
.ngo-letter-selected { color: #f5faff; font-size: 13px; font-family: arial; font-weight: bold; background-color: #80a4c1; text-decoration: none; margin: 0; padding: 5px; }
a.ngo-letter:hover { color: #184970; padding: 4px; border: solid 1px; }
#new-submenu { background-color: #ccd9e4; left: 0; top: 23px; position: absolute; width: 124px; z-index: 2; visibility: hidden; padding: 0; border: solid 1px #0e5881; }

